The World Bank and the ministry of finance today signed a $110.1 million project for the rural poor in Madhya Pradesh. The programme, to be known as the Madhya Pradesh District Poverty Initiative Project, is part of the new series of lending opertions of the World Bank that seeks to improve opportunities for the rural poor to meet priority social and economic needs.
